Nursing
Nursing is studied at 2,135 institutes across 33 states in India, as recorded in AISHE data. Combined approved seat intake across all institutes offering Nursing is 154,208 students per year. Programmes in this discipline run 1 to 5 years.

Frequently Asked Questions
How many institutes offer Nursing?
2,135 institutes across 33 states offer programmes in Nursing, according to AISHE data.
What programs are offered in Nursing?
Nursing includes the following programmes: G.N.M.-General Nursing & Midwifery, A.N.M.-Auxiliary Nurse & Midwife, B.Sc.(Nursing)-Bachelor of Science in Nursing, Certificate-Certificate, B.Sc.(Post Basic)-B.Sc (Post Basic), Diploma-Diploma, M.Sc. Nursing-Master of Science in Nursing, Post Graduate Diploma, Post Basic B.Sc. Nursing(PB-B.Sc.), B.Sc.-Bachelor of Science, M.Sc.-Master of Science, Ph.D.-Doctor of Philosophy, and 12 more.
What is the total seat intake for Nursing?
The combined approved intake across all institutes offering Nursing is 154,208 seats per year.
What types of institutions offer Nursing?
Among institutes offering Nursing: 129 universitys, 886 standalone institutions, 1,107 colleges.
How long do Nursing programmes take to complete?
Programmes in Nursing typically take 1 to 5 years to complete, based on AISHE-reported durations.
